Dilbag Singh, a farmer leader and a witness in the Lakhimpur Kheri case, was shot in UP

Dilbag Singh, a Bhartiya Kisan Union (BKU) leader and a witness in the Lakhimpur Kheri violence case, was brutally attacked in the district by two unidentified persons.

On Tuesday night, the BKU (Tikait) district president was returning home in his SUV from Aliganj-Muda route in Gola kotwali area when he was attacked. Mr. Singh, on the other hand, was unharmed in the attack.

FIR has been filed against two anonymous people. The attackers allegedly burst a tyre on Singh’s SUV and then fired shots through the driver’s side window pane, according to Singh.

Mr Singh stated that he was driving the SUV alone.

He claimed that as he sensed the attackers’ intentions, he folded the driver’s seat and bent down towards the floor. Because the car windows were obscured by dark film, the attackers were unable to determine the status of the BKU leader inside the SUV and escaped on their motorcycles.
